When Mysore Warriors took the field against Namma Shivamogga side in their Maharaja Trophy match, there was a familiar surname in the Mysore team’s lineup — Samit Dravid.
Son of India’s batting legend and former coach, Rahul Dravid, Samit made his Maharaja Trophy debut on Thursday, which understandably got the fans excited and it exhibited in their reaction on social media.
Slotted at No. 4 after Mysore were asked to bat first by Shivammoga, Samit didn’t have a memorable outing, scoring only 7 runs. But that didn’t disappoint fans, as there were more happy to see the next-generation Dravid in action.

Even though rain didn’t allow the full 20 overs of Shivamogga’s run-chase to be bowled, Mysore emerged victorious by 7 runs (DLS method) as they reduced the Shivamogga side to 80 for 5 in 9 overs after putting up a competitive 159 for 8 on the board.
Samit is playing a state’s T20 league for the first time. The 18-year-old all-rounder, who bowls medium pace and bats in the middle order, was bought by Mysore for INR 50,000 in the auction.
He has represented the Karnataka Under-19 side and was part of the team that won the Cooch Behar Trophy 2023-24.
